Understanding Wooden Pallets
Wooden pallets are flat structures used for carrying and storing goods. They are typically made from various kinds of wood and be available in numerous sizes, with the most typical being the basic 48 inches by 40 inches (1200 mm by 1000 mm) used in North America. Wooden pallets play a crucial role in logistics, as they help with easier handling, packing, and dumping of goods.

Benefits of Wooden Pallet Depots
Ecological Sustainability: Wooden pallet depots promote recycling and reusing pallets, substantially minimizing lumber waste and logging.
Cost-Efficiency: Businesses can save money by fixing and reusing pallets instead of continuously buying new ones.
Quality assurance: Wooden pallet depots keep rigorous quality control steps to guarantee that refurbished pallets fulfill security and toughness standards.
Minimized Carbon Footprint: By extending the life process of wooden pallets, depots add to reducing the overall carbon footprint of logistics operations.
Improved Inventory Management: Depots provide companies with effective management of pallet inventories, enabling for much better tracking and utilization.

How do I choose the best wooden pallet for my needs?
When selecting a wooden pallet, think about elements such as load capacity, resilience, and whether you require block or stringer styles based upon your storage and transport requirements.
2. What is the average lifespan of a wooden pallet?
The life-span of a wooden pallet can differ considerably depending upon usage and upkeep. A well-kept pallet can last anywhere from 5 to 15 years.
3. What should I do with damaged pallets?
Damaged pallets can typically be repaired to extend their life. If repair is not feasible, lots of wooden pallet depots will accept them for recycling.
4. Are there guidelines concerning the usage of wooden pallets?
Yes, specific industries, such as food and pharmaceuticals, have specific policies concerning the use and treatment of wooden pallets to ensure safety and hygiene.
